Auburn Oaks sits in the heart of Polk County's Auburndale, a part of Central Florida built around lakes, oak-lined streets, and a slower pace between Tampa and Orlando. Homes here run large — the median size is around 2,900 square feet — which makes it a fit for buyers who want space without the price tags you'd see closer to the coast. Families lean on assigned schools like Walter Caldwell Elementary and Auburndale Senior High, and neighboring communities like Lake Juliana Estates and Water Ridge round out the area's mix of lakeside and established options.
The market here is small and tightly held. There's just one active listing at $489,900, and only two homes sold in the past year at a median of $464,500 — so when something comes up, it moves. Is Auburn Oaks a good place to live?+
It's a solid pick for buyers who want larger homes and a quieter, established Auburndale setting with low monthly costs. The neighborhood feeds into Walter Caldwell Elementary and Auburndale Senior High, and it sits near lake-focused communities like Lake Juliana Estates. It suits families and anyone wanting space without a long commute across Central Florida.
Is Auburn Oaks expensive?+
It's mid-range for the area — the single active listing is priced at $489,900, and the median home is around 2,900 square feet at roughly $169 per square foot. Add a low $35 monthly HOA and about $1,909 a year in property taxes, and the ongoing costs stay reasonable.
What do homes cost in Auburn Oaks?+
Right now the one active home is listed at $489,900, and over the past 12 months two homes sold at a median of $464,500. If you want more choices at different price points, it's worth comparing against the broader pool of Auburndale homes for sale.
How is the market in Auburn Oaks?+
It's a low-inventory market with just one active listing and two sales in the past year, so competitive but not frantic. Sellers here averaged about 93% of their asking price, which tells you there's room to negotiate on the right home. When a listing appears, expect it to draw attention quickly.
What about HOA fees and property taxes?+
The median HOA in Auburn Oaks is a modest $35 per month, and property taxes run about $1,909 a year. Those are both on the lower end for the space you get, and comparable to nearby options like Auburndale Heights.
